10.00 points QP Corp. sold 5,330 units of its product at $46.70 per unit in year 2015 and incurred operating expenses of $7.70 per unit in selling the units. It began the year with 770 units in inventory and made successive purchases of its product as follows. Jan. 1 Beginning inventory Feb. 20 Purchase May 16 Purchase Oct. 3 Purchase Dec. 11 Purchase 770 units $19.70 per unit 1,670 units$20.70 per unit 870 units $21.70 per unt 570 units $22.70 per unit 3.470 units$23.70 per unit Total 7.350 units Required 1. Prepare comparative income statements for the three inventory costing methods of FIFO, LIFO, and weighted average which includes a detailed cost of goods sold section as part of each statement. The company uses a periodic inventory system, and its income tax rate is 40%. (Round your average cost per unit to 2 decimal places.)
